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

let-502Rho-associated protein kinase let-502; Negatively regulates mel-11 to relieve the inhibition of mlc- 4, allowing contraction of the circumferentially oriented microfilaments in epidermal cells and thereby regulating myosin II contractility during spermathecal contraction, cleavage furrow contraction in early embryos, and embryonic elongation and morphogenesis. Required for P-cell migration. May also play a role in oocyte cellularization. (1173 aa)

apr-1Adenomatous polyposis coli protein-related protein 1; Has a role in endoderm cell specification and pharyngeal development. Required for the migration of epithelial cells, organization of the anterior seam cells and ceh-13 expression during embryo morphogenesis. Prevents hyperactivation of the Wnt signaling pathway during endoderm development, probably by preventing hmp-2 nuclear translocation. During larval development, apr-1 is required for expression of lin-39 in P3-8.p. Shown to negatively regulate Wnt signaling in vulval precursor cells. rho-1Ras-like GTP-binding protein rhoA; Required for ventral migration of epidermal cells during ventral enclosure in the embryo and for cell elongation. Also required for ventral migration of P cells during larval development. Involved in asymmetric spindle positioning during anaphase and establishment of cell polarity during embryo development. In adults, involved in regulation of multiple processes including locomotion, pharyngeal pumping, fecundity, ovulation, defecation and body morphology.
